Is it Worth Buying Samsung Galaxy M53 5G?
Samsung has already Galaxy M52 5G at 25k and now they have launched an all-new Galaxy M53 5G at the same price, the thing is the Galaxy M53 5G is a downgrade from the Galaxy M52 5G.
Looks like things are getting expensive in 2022 which we have seen in recent mobile launches and also, this is Samsung, so they will charge a premium than any other mobile brand.
The Samsung Galaxy M53 5G price in India starts at Rs 23,999 for 6GB RAM + 128GB storage while the 8GB RAM + 128GB storage variant is priced at Rs 25,999. The device is available in Mint Green and Blue color options and it will be available from April 29th, 2022 via Amazon IN at noon.

Is it Worth buying Samsung Galaxy M53 5G?
Yes, Samsung Galaxy M53 5G is worth buying for those users who wanted to buy the latest Samsung smartphone but for those who want a value for money device, Galaxy M53 5G is not the best option, you can consider the RealMe 9 Pro Plus 5G which offers value and it also has better specs then Galaxy M53 5G.
One thing you will see on Galaxy M53 5G buy page is the 108MP camera smartphone…
There is no doubt that a bigger sensor provides details images but you also need to see, how did company optimize the 108MP sensor.

In this case, Samsung needs to work on the camera department to justify the 108MP sensor and even 24k price tag. Still, if you want to know more about the camera then make sure you read my full review of the Galaxy M53 5G…
The MediaTek Dimensity 900 is a good processor but it’s not a powerful processor, so if you’re a heavy gamer then you will be disappointed with the performance, it’s a good chipset for day-to-day use and casual gaming.
Fun fact, Samsung didn’t include a 25W charger in the box, you have to pay Rs 1,999 to Samsung to buy the 25W charger separately.
That 5000mAh battery will last for a day but in the end, it will depend on how you use the smartphone in day to day life.
The 420 nits of brightness would be okay for a 15k smartphone but the Galaxy M53 5G is priced at 24k, so this is not justifiable at all.

The Samsung Galaxy M53 5G comes with a 5.70-inches 120Hz sAMOLED display with a resolution of 1080 x 2408 pixels and 420nits of screen brightness. On the front, Samsung has used Corning Gorilla Glass 5 while the frame and back are made out of plastic.
Verdict
Talking about myself, I don’t buy a new smartphone by looking at the logo, I look at the value it offers, and in this case, Galaxy M53 5G doesn’t offer value at 24k, so I would not consider buying the Galaxy M53 5G.
Still, if you feel, I want to buy Samsung branded smartphone and I don’t trust any other brands then you can consider the Galaxy M52 5G because this is a better Samsung smartphone than the newly launched Galaxy M53 5G.

Samsung Galaxy M53 5G Specifications
Launch Date | 22 April 2022 |
Available From | 29th April 2022 via Amazon at noon |
Display | 6.70-inches FHD+ sAMOLED Touch sampling rate Up to 240Hz 394ppi density 420 nits pick the brightness |
Resolution | 1080 x 2400 pixels resolution |
Dimensions | 164.7 x 77 x 7.4 mm |
Protection | Corning Gorilla Glass 5 (front) |
Screen Refresh Rate | 90Hz Refresh Rate |
Build | Glass front (Gorilla Glass 5), Plastic frame, Plastic back |
OS | Android 12 – OneUI 4.1 |
Chipset | MediaTek Dimensity 920 5G (6 nm) GPU: Mali-G68 MC4 CPU: Octa-core (2×2.4 GHz Cortex-A78 & 6×2.0 GHz Cortex-A55) |
Storage | 6GB Ram + 128GB Storage 8GB Ram + 128GB Storage |
Card Slot | Yes |
Rear Cameras | 108MP Primary Sensor 8 MP Ultra-Wide 2 MP Macro 2 MP Depth |
Video | [email protected] [email protected]/60fps |
Front Camera | 32MP Selfie Shooter |
Video | [email protected] [email protected]/60fps |
3.5mm Jack | No |
Stereo Speakers | No |
Carrier Aggregation | Yes |
Bluetooth Version | 5.2 |
5G Support | Yes |
5G Bands | Unspecified |
IR Blaster | No |
Sensors | Fingerprint (side-mounted), accelerometer, gyro, proximity, compass |
Fingerprint Sensor | Side-Mounted |
Battery | 5,000 mAh (non-removable) |
Charging Speed | 25W wired fast Charging No Charger in the Box |
Colors | Mint Green and Blue |
SAR Value | – |
Model Number | SM-M536B, SM-M536B/DS |
Weight | 176 Gram |
Benchmark Score | – |
Price | 6GB Ram + 128GB storage: Rs 23,999 8GB Ram + 128GB storage: Rs 25,999 |
In the box | Samsung Galaxy M53 5G USB Type-C cable Guide papers SIM tool |
Available at | Amazon IN |
